Check documentation on flags for FileOpen() command, especially this part:

 

There are some specific features of work when you specify read and write flags:

If FILE_READ is specified, an attempt is made to open an existing file. If a file does not exist, file opening fails, a new file is not created.

FILE_READ|FILE_WRITE — a new file is created if the file with the specified name does not exist.

FILE_WRITE —  the file is created again with a zero size.

actually, the answer you got there was the right one. The manual is not really clear about it, but you have to include FILE_READ in order for your file not to get zeroed each time you open it

macpee: idea is to add a new record each time the program loops. The file closes within the loop, but should retain the initial records at next open.
I am not reading, I am WRITING (adding records). No you are not. This create a empty file. This is what drazen64 already told you.
int FetchHandle=FileOpen("FetchFile.txt",FILE_WRITE|FILE_CSV|FILE_TXT);
You need to append to a file (note the FILE_READ|FILE_WRITE and the seek to end)
      int      CREATE   = FILE_WRITE|FILE_TXT|FILE_ANSI;
      int      APPEND   = FILE_READ|CREATE;
      string   fileName = WindowExpertName() + ".DBG";
      HANDLE   handle   = FileOpen(fileName, APPEND);
      if(handle != INVALID_HANDLE){
         FileSeek(handle, 0, SEEK_END);
         FileWrite(handle, s);
         FileClose(handle);
